WebNov 18, 2024 · Repositioning Splint This guard works by repositioning the lower jaw (mandible) either forward or backward. While this may relieve the pressure on the jaw, it can also permanently change your bite. This is a device that should only be used for a short period of time and under close supervision by your dentist. TMJ can result in facial changes as the muscles are forced to work differently with some over working and others under working. If the bite and/or jaw is off balance, teeth can shift and bone loss can occur which also changes the facial appearance. WebSep 6, 2024 · An impact on the face may change the structure of the jaw bones and cause asymmetry. 3. Alignment Of Teeth If your teeth are uneven, the jaws will undergo structural changes and develop differently. Crooked teeth will strain the jaw muscles and not permit the jaws to achieve a correct bite or settle in their normal position.
